Forum: PC Hard- und Software Serialtest schlägt fehl


von R. S. (operaiter)


Lesenswert?

Guten Morgen zusammen,

ich versuche zur Zeit meinem Atmega beizubringen via UART mit meinem PC 
zu kommunizieren. Dabei habe ich dummerweise ein Problem. Nein keine 
Sorge ich bin hier trotzdem ich richtigen Bereich da ich das Problem 
schon grob eingrenzen konnte.

Irgendwo im "Wiki" steht geschrieben das man bei Problemen den RX und TX 
Pin hinter dem Max232 brücken soll. Wenn man nun eine Eingabe in die 
Konsole macht sollte man sein eigenes Echo sehen.
Dies passiert bei mir leider nicht.

Jetzt denkt sich der pfiffige da hat er wohl mist beim Max232 gemacht. 
Dachte ich erst auch. Daher habe ich direkt die TX und RX Pins am 
Serialport gebrückt und erhalte ebenfalls kein echo.

Und das ist nun der Grund warum ich ein Hardware defekt seitens meines 
MC's erstmal außenvorlassen kann.

Ich bin einfach zu doof PuttyTel so zu konfigurieren das es 
funktioniert.

Oder habe ich hier einen anderen Denkfehler? Ich würde mich sehr über 
Hilfe oder Tipps freuen die mich hier nun weiterbringen könnten!!

Vielen Dank im Vorraus!
LG OP

von HildeK (Gast)


Lesenswert?

R. S. schrieb:
> Ich bin einfach zu doof PuttyTel so zu konfigurieren das es
> funktioniert.

Naja: Selbsterkenntnis ist der erste Weg zur Besserung :-).

Wenn RX und TX (Pins 2 und 3 am neunpoligen Kabel, ohne MAX232) gebrückt 
sind, sollte schon was gehen.
Schau mal nach dem Handshake (Flow control). Dort sollte jegliche Art 
von Handshake ausgeschaltet sein. Parity ebenso auf aus, sollte aber bei 
der PC-Loop trotzdem gehen. Weitere Fehlermöglichkeiten: falschen 
COM-Port eingestellt.
Alternativ: es gibt auch andere Teminal-SW (TeraTerm z.B.), die ev. 
einfacher zu konfigurieren ist.

von Reinhard Kern (Gast)


Lesenswert?

Hallo,

erste Massnahme ist immer, einen Tester dranzuhängen - da du vermutlich 
keinen hast, tut es auch eine Led mit Vorwiderstand an TxD. Du kannst 
zwar nicht schnell genug schauen um festzustellen, ob die Impulse 
korrekt sind, aber am Flackern siehst du ob überhaupt was rausgeht, 
besonders wenn du niedrige Baudraten einstellst.

Gruss Reinhard

von R. S. (operaiter)


Lesenswert?

HildeK schrieb:
> Naja: Selbsterkenntnis ist der erste Weg zur Besserung :-).

Aber nicht immer die Lösung ;)

Fehler war nicht wie befürchtet die Konfiguration von PuttyTel 
(Handshake usw hatte ich schon deaktiviert) sondern  viel schlimmer das 
Korrekte ablesen eines "Schaltplanes".

Diese Pinbelegung habe ich Spielgelverkehrt angelötet.
http://helmut.hullen.de/filebox/Technik/RS232.jpg

So konnte das natürlich nichts werden.

Der LED-Test hat mich dann zur Lösung gebracht. Bin mit der 
Klemmeabgerutscht und versehentlich an den benachbarten Pin gekommen. 
Daraufhin habe ich mir das Datenblatt nochmal angeschaut und überlegt ob 
ich einfach zu dämlich zum löten bin.

In diesem Sinne vielen Dank für die Zeit die ihr für mich geopfert habt!
Ich wünsche euch noch ein schönes Wochenende

LG OP

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.